01. Limitations on military weaponry acquired by District law enforcement agencies. (a) Beginning in Fiscal Year 2021, District law enforcement agencies shall not acquire the following property through any program operated by the federal government: (1) Ammunition of .50 caliber or higher; (2) Armed or armored vehicles, including aircraft and watercraft; (3) Bayonets; (4) Explosives or pyrotechnics, including grenades; (5) Firearm silencers; (6) Firearms of .50 caliber or higher; (7) Objects designed or capable of launching explosives or pyrotechnics, including grenade launchers, firearms, and firearms accessories; and (8) Remotely piloted, powered aircraft without a crew aboard, including drones. (c) Within 180 days after July 22, 2020, District law enforcement agencies shall: (1) Return or dispose of any property described in subsection (a) of this section that the agencies currently possess; and (2) Publish an inventory of the property returned or disposed of as described in paragraph (1) of this subsection on a publicly accessible website.
